R673 AJO is a 1998 Saab 9000 Cs in Silver with a 2,290c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 10 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 60%.
Across all 1998 Saab 9000 Cs models, the average MOT pass rate is 66.4% with a typical mileage of 122,644 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Saab 9000 Cs fails its MOT is parking brake: efficiency below requirements, accounting for 2,064 recorded failures. If you're considering buying R673 AJO,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Saab 9000 Cs typically stays on UK roads for around 35 years. At 28 years old, this Saab 9000 Cs is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
